#d3bfcb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3bfcb is composed of 82.7% red, 74.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.5%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 324 degrees, a saturation of 18.5% and a lightness of 78.8%. #d3bfcb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a77f97.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#d3bfcb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060405 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3bfcb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bc7c9 is the less saturated color, while #fd95d3 is the most saturated one.
